| Inorganic Chemistry |
| Born 1949. B.S., 1970, National Taiwan Univ.; Ph.D., 1975, Univ. of
Chicago. Research Associate, 1975-76, Northwestern Univ. Associate Professor,
1976-80; Professor, 1980-; Chairman, 1987-90, Dept. of Chemistry, NTU. Humboldt
Research Fellow of Germany, 1983-84. Research Fellow, 1982-; Acting Director,
1985-87, Institute of Chemistry, Academia Sinica; Academician, 1998, Academia Sinica.
Research Interests 1. Synthesis and characterizations of metal complexes which have delocalized ground
states and possess unusual redox, spectroscopic, magnetic, and structural properties.
e.g. metal complex of o-quinonediimine, diiminosuccino-nitrile, and fully conjugated
macrocycles. |
